IBIT is trading at $43.38, up 5.30% on August 21, 2026, after U.S. Treasury’s August 19 decision to raise long-term bond-buyback limits from $2 billion to at least $4 billion per operation, easing yield and liquidity concerns.

  • Heavy short liquidations amplified Bitcoin’s advance; improving digital-asset regulatory expectations added support.
  • The broader market was only modestly higher; the move was crypto-sector and macro-liquidity driven, not broad-equity-led.
  • Bitcoin’s August 20 surge above $72,000 and reported multibillion-dollar short squeeze created positive momentum into the August 21 session.
